Rugged Resilience: Umidigi BISON GT2’s Military-Grade Toughness
The Umidigi BISON GT2 isn’t just another smartphone; it’s a statement of endurance engineered for environments where standard devices falter. Its core identity is built upon exceptional durability, certified to meet the rigorous MIL-STD-810G standards. This isn’t merely a marketing claim; it signifies the device has undergone a battery of demanding tests simulating real-world abuse far beyond everyday knocks. Achieving this certification involves subjecting the phone to extreme conditions, including repeated drops from significant heights onto hard surfaces, exposure to intense vibrations simulating vehicle travel or machinery operation, extreme temperature fluctuations from freezing cold to scorching heat, and high levels of humidity. The GT2 emerges unscathed, validating its readiness for construction sites, hiking trails, industrial settings, or simply the clumsier moments of daily life.
This toughness stems from a meticulously crafted robust chassis. The BISON GT2 employs a reinforced polycarbonate frame – a material prized in rugged gear for its excellent impact absorption and resistance to deformation. This frame acts as the primary shock absorber, effectively dissipating the energy from drops and impacts. Integrated within this structure is a rigid metal skeleton, providing crucial internal reinforcement and structural integrity, preventing the phone from flexing or bending under pressure. The strategic placement of thick, shock-absorbing TPU (Thermoplastic Polyurethane) bumpers at vulnerable corners and edges provides a critical first line of defense, cushioning direct impacts. Every port, including the USB-C charging port and headphone jack, is protected by secure, reinforced rubberized flaps. These are designed to withstand constant opening and closing while ensuring a tight seal against environmental ingress. The physical buttons (power and volume) are also robust, requiring a deliberate press, minimizing accidental activation and enhancing their longevity.
Environmental sealing is paramount. The BISON GT2 boasts an impressive IP68/IP69K rating. The IP68 rating guarantees complete protection against dust ingress (the “6”) and the ability to withstand continuous submersion in fresh water up to 1.5 meters deep for 30 minutes (the “8”). Crucially, the IP69K rating elevates this further, certifying the phone can resist high-pressure, high-temperature water jets – think being sprayed down with a pressure washer or caught in a heavy downpour while working outdoors. This combination makes the GT2 impervious to dust, dirt, sand, rain, spills, and accidental dunks, whether on a dusty trail, a muddy job site, or simply near a sink. Protecting the display is a critical layer of Corning Gorilla Glass. While the exact generation isn’t always specified for rugged models, Umidigi utilizes a strengthened version specifically chosen for its enhanced scratch resistance and ability to survive face-down drops onto rough surfaces without shattering. The glass is slightly recessed within the frame, offering added protection against direct impacts on the screen itself. Powering Through: The BISON GT2’s Marathon Battery and Efficient Charging
Complementing its rugged exterior is the Umidigi BISON GT2’s remarkable longevity powerhouse. At its heart lies a massive 6150mAh lithium-polymer battery. This substantial capacity isn’t just a number; it translates directly into tangible, extended usage that liberates users from the constant anxiety of finding a power outlet. In practical terms, the GT2 consistently delivers multi-day battery life under typical mixed usage patterns. This includes several hours of screen-on time for browsing, social media, email, navigation, and moderate camera use, spread comfortably over two full days, and often stretching into a third day for lighter users. Even under heavier loads, such as extended gaming sessions demanding sustained processor and graphics performance, or prolonged GPS navigation with the screen constantly active, the GT2 demonstrates exceptional stamina, easily lasting a full day and well into the next without needing a recharge. For users who prioritize communication and essential tasks, the standby time is exceptional, measured in weeks rather than days, making it an ideal backup phone or reliable companion for infrequent users or emergency situations.
Managing this immense power reserve efficiently is crucial. The BISON GT2 leverages hardware and software optimizations to maximize every milliamp-hour. The MediaTek Helio G85 processor, while capable for everyday tasks and moderate gaming, is inherently more power-efficient than flagship chipsets, generating less heat and consuming less energy during typical operations. Umidigi’s Android implementation (usually near-stock) includes intelligent power management features. These features dynamically adjust background app activity, restrict battery drain from idle apps, optimize screen brightness algorithms, and manage network connectivity (Wi-Fi, Bluetooth, mobile data) to minimize unnecessary power consumption. Users have granular control through standard Android battery saver modes, which can further extend endurance by throttling performance, reducing background data, and limiting location services when the battery dips low. The large battery capacity also means that even significant daily usage, such as 5-6 hours of screen time, often leaves the battery level comfortably above 50% by evening, instilling confidence for the next day’s adventures without scrambling for a charger.
When it does come time to replenish the sizable 6150mAh cell, the Umidigi BISON GT2 supports 18W fast charging via its USB-C port. While not the absolute fastest charging standard available today, this 18W capability strikes a practical balance. It provides a significant speed boost compared to standard 5W or 10W chargers, especially important given the large battery capacity. Real-world charging times see the GT2 go from 0% to around 30-40% in roughly 30 minutes, providing a substantial emergency boost. A full charge from empty typically takes approximately 2.5 to 3 hours. The inclusion of a programmable charging feature enhances long-term battery health. This allows users to set charging schedules (e.g., only charging to 80% overnight and completing to 100% just before waking), helping to mitigate the degradation that occurs when lithium batteries are held at maximum voltage for extended periods. While wireless charging is absent – a common trade-off in rugged designs prioritizing durability and sealing over added components – the reliable wired fast charging and the sheer longevity provided by the massive battery make this omission easily justified for the target user seeking dependable, long-lasting power in challenging conditions.
